log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

Ubuntu下Goland如何设置桌面快捷方式

查看了网上很多在linux下设置goland的快捷方式,但都有一点繁琐(只是自己懒)方法一:这有一个简简单单的一条命令(进入终端): sudo ln -s /home/wkl/下载/GoLand-2018.2.3/bin/goland.sh   /usr/bin/goland注意: /home/wkl/下载/GoLand-2018.2.3/bin/goland.sh3  是我goland...

Mac SecureCRT安装、破解和使用(mac版)

安装百度云盘下载提取码为:vhyq特别注意!!!此时不要双击点击破解打开终端CD到下载文件内cd Downloads/win-mac\ scrt\&sfx  看到破解文件,输入命令CRTdesudo perl securecrt_linux_crack.pl /Applications/SecureCRT.app/Contents/MacOS/Se...

第03节:怎么针对微服务架构做单元测试?

单元测试是开发人员编写的一小段代码,用于检验被测代码的一个很小的、很明确的功能是否正确。通常而言,一个单元测试是用于判断某个特定条件(或者场景)下某个特定函数的行为。例如,你可能把一个很大的值放入一个有序 list 中去,然后确认该值出现在 list 的尾部。或者,你可能会从字符串中删除匹配某种模式的字符,然后确认字符串确实不再包含这些字符了。对于单元测试中单元的含义,一般来说,要根据实际情况..

#微服务
第07节:端到端测试的优化策略

上篇中的契约测试解决了我们对微服务之间协作、交互的验证需求。本达人课到目前为止介绍的测试都是后端或者 API 级别的测试,可以说都属于“白盒测试”。自动化测试的最后一步,就是所谓的端到端测试(End-to-End Test),又称黑盒测试,即从用户角度验证整个系统的功能,看其从启动到结束是否全部符合用户预期。黑盒测试:又被称为功能测试、数据驱动测试或基于规格说明的测试,是通过使用整个软件或某...

第05节:组件测试详解

本课程中所说的组件(Component),是指一个大型系统中,某一个可以独立工作的、封装完整的组成部分。在微服务架构中,组件实际上就代表着微服务本身,或者说单个微服务。以下将其称为“单服务测试”(Single-service Test)。这个测试的实质,就是将一个微服务与其所依赖的所有其他服务或资源全部隔离开,从该服务外部“用户”的角度来审视服务能否提供预期的输出。这样做有很多好处:通过把...

#微服务
一个很不错的bash脚本编写教程

一个很不错的bash脚本编写教程建立一个脚本  Linux中有好多中不同的shell,但是通常我们使用bash (bourne again shell) 进行shell编程,因为bash是免费的并且很容易使用。所以在本文中笔者所提供的脚本都是使用bash(但是在大多数情况下,这些脚本同样可以在 bash的大姐,bourne shell中运行)。  如同其他语言一样,通过我们使用任意一种文字编...

云计算到底是怎么玩的(入门介绍)

“云计算”这个词,相信大家都非常熟悉了。作为IT行业的热门技术,它频繁出现在各大媒体的新闻报道中。BAT这样的互联网企业,也经常把它挂在嘴边。相信很多人都想学习云计算,跟上技术潮流。如果对云计算有一定了解的话,应该会或多或少地听到这些名词——OpenStack、Hypervisor、KVM、Docker、K8S...这些名词,全部都属于云计算的范畴。对于自学的初学者来说,想要理...

#云计算#docker
postman批量生产body信息(实现批量修改数据)

需求文档:更新候选人自定义信息测试用例执行:用例信息API接口http://api-platform.staging-8.svc.k8s.staging.mokahr.com:8080/api-platform/v1/candidate/customField/updateJava内部接口http://ats-candidate-offline.staging-8.svc.k8s.staging.

#postman
Git基本操作入门

 安装客户端mac$ brew install gitCentOS$ yum install gitDebian/Ubuntu$ apt-get install git配置用户名  $ git config [--global] user.name "[name]" $ git config [--global] u...

第06节:契约测试入门

在前面几篇文章中,我们学习了怎么对一个微服务,实施从单元到整体的全部测试。下一步,我们就需要考虑怎么测试不同微服务之间的协同、交互。如果采用传统的总体测试方法,对服务之间的协作进行验证,那么随着服务数量和调用关系复杂度的增加,必须面临成本呈现指数级增长的挑战,这表现在:验证成本高:为了验证多个服务协作后的功能正确与否,需要为每个服务搭建基础设施(包括其依赖的数据库、缓存等),并执行部署、配...

#微服务
    共 11 条
  • 1
  • 2
  • 请选择